    Characteristics and Tasting Notes of the "Adrianna River" Malbec 2023 Bodega Catena Zapata

    Tasting

    Appearance
    This wine reveals a deep garnet colour, enhanced by brilliant violet highlights.

    Nose
    The bouquet is particularly open and lively, offering elegant floral notes underpinned by a fine mineral tension reminiscent of stone.

    Palate
    On the palate, the attack is delicate and lively, revealing a taut texture. Despite remarkable power and richness, the whole retains immense finesse. The finish is long-lasting, concentrated and persistent, offering an airy expression that ranks among the estate's lightest and most elevated wines.

    Food and Wine Pairing

    This cuvée pairs wonderfully with grilled, roasted or braised red meats. It will also brilliantly accompany slow-cooked dishes in sauce, aged cheeses, or dishes with umami flavours such as certain Asian specialities.

    Serving and Cellaring

    To fully enjoy the "Adrianna River" Malbec 2023, it is recommended to serve it at a temperature between 16 and 18°C. With excellent ageing potential, it can be cellared and enjoyed until around 2043.

    Other Characteristics

    This wine has an alcohol content of 13.6% along with an acidity of 6.9 g/L. Its pH generally sits around 3.6, and its residual sugar level is very low, close to 1.8 g/L.

    The Airy Expression of a Great Malbec from Mendoza by Bodega Catena Zapata

    The Estate

    Founded in 1902 by Nicola Catena, the Bodega Catena Zapata brand is a true benchmark in Argentina. The estate played a pioneering role in the revival of Malbec and the development of high-altitude viticulture. Today, the family estate is led by its owner Nicolás Catena, supported by Laura Catena as managing director. Combining scientific research with respect for terroir, the house produces exceptional cuvées recognised worldwide.

    The Vineyard

    This cuvée comes from the River plot, a tiny 2.6-hectare parcel located within the Adrianna vineyard in Gualtallary, in the Mendoza region. Rising to 1,366 metres in altitude, this certified organic terroir sits on a former riverbed. The alluvial soils are covered with oval white stones rich in calcium carbonate, ensuring excellent drainage and optimal thermal regulation for the vines.

    Winemaking and Ageing

    The making of the "Adrianna River" Malbec 2023 begins with a ten-day cold pre-fermentation maceration. The vinification includes a high proportion of whole cluster fermentation, ranging from 60 to 80% whole bunches. The wine is then carefully aged for 21 months in one- and two-year-old French oak barrels, preserving the full purity of the fruit and the identity of the terroir.

    Grape Variety

    This cuvée is made from 100% Malbec.
